CVE-2024-35431 is a directory traversal vulnerability affecting ZKTeco ZKBio CVSecurity, specifically versions 6.1.1 and potentially up to 6.4.1. This flaw allows an unauthenticated attacker to download local files from the server by manipulating the photoBase64 parameter. With a CVSS score of 7.5 (HIGH), it presents a significant risk due to its network-based attack vector and low attack complexity, leading to high confidentiality impact. Currently, there is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this vulnerability.
